is so good that you never want to leave. One of the most popular
venues in the part ofEngland
is Oundle. Set in rolling Northamptonshire countryside, Oundle still
occupies the same site near the picturesque market town of Oundle,
as it did when it was founded in 1893.
Most holes call for careful placement from the
tee with the smallish greens requiring accurate shot making. The
course has a reputation for its preparation and presentation and
will not disappoint.
Another standout course is Staverton Park, a luxurious
18-hole golf course set in 140 acres of beautiful Northamptonshire
countryside. With four small lakes and 64 American-style sand traps,
it is ideal for golfers of all abilities.
